  • Visiting Instructor, School of Marketing

    University of Southern Mississippi (Hattiesburg, MS)



    Apply Now

    Special Instructions to Applicants

     

    To ensure full consideration, completed application materials (including a cover letter, teaching philosophy, and three letters of recommendation) should be submitted to The University of Southern Mississippi website at https://jobs.usm.edu by the priority deadline of Friday, October 10, 2025. Questions should be directed to Dr. Melinda McLelland at [email protected].

    Job Summary

    The School of Marketing in the College of Business and Economic Development at The University of Southern Mississippi invites applicants to apply for a nine-month position of Visiting Instructor of Marketing beginning in August 2026. This position is for the Hattiesburg campus and will support our growing face-to-face and online Marketing degrees, minors, and certificates. The successful candidate will provide instruction in undergraduate and potentially graduate courses, teach 12 semester credit hours per term, and participate in School events and functions. While this is a visiting appointment, renewal may be possible based on performance and budgetary approval.

     

    Primary Duties and Responsibilities

     

    + Teach four courses per semester (or equivalent) to be determined by the Director of the School. The successful candidate's teaching obligations will support the Marketing BSBA degree, minors, and certificate programs.

    + Primary teaching responsibilities will support the Marketing BSBA but may also include support of related programs.

    + The desired candidate will be willing and able to teach various Marketing courses, such as Principles of Marketing, Creative Marketing, Marketing Analytics, and others as needed.

    + Faculty are expected to maintain quality teaching (both online and in-person).

    + Faculty are expected to work well in a team environment and participate in School events and functions.

    + Additional responsibilities may include mentoring undergraduate students, recruitment, and other duties as assigned.
